So i tested a druid build and it was midly successful, and wondering what you guys would suggest build wise to try for SPVP for a healer buffer that can land buffs and throw in some offensive ccs to help cc for group and maintain some sustain?

I want to see how well i can do with ele just for fun in healings and buff, and if it goes well il report here my findings.

I enjoyed the feeling of support and a very high octane battle where you are tense and nervous healing everyone trying to keep everyone alive and bunches of people being downed and manage to save some since ele is a solid healer.

In WvW ele is a solid healer, if not the best raw healer in the game.

Unfortunately for Spvp, you just can’t get high enough stats, proper runes/sigils or number of players to make full heal ele useful.

You can run support elementalist, which is mostly a hybrid cc controller and Aura spammer, which can be played to a nice capacity. Staff support is a good Rez bot (altho after patch I’m not sure how it is now) but you’ll have trouble if you play to heal because you simply can’t heal players good enough in Spvp vs all the damage.

Aside from the Staff/(D/Wh) Tempest, I have been trying another build for the past few days.

I picked Earth(3-3-3)/Water(1-1-2), and depending on if you need more cleanses, you can swap out the Major Grandmaster traits in either/both lines.

Tempest line is (1/3)-(1/3)-3

D/F for the weapon set.

For the utilities I had Aftershock, Mistform and... Glyph of Renewal (I saved myself with Fire many times, rez'd many in Earth and safely rez'd an ally in Air)

I've played the build in WvW only so I can't really give an opinion for SPvP although the build is SPvP-inspired.

It's been only like a day or two, so I can't really give full feedback, but it's really fun and does a fine job.
